The music of John Denver has drawn millions to the down-home feel and universal messages of folk music. The body of work he laid out for others to follow can also serve as a master plan from which his fans can learn how to play folk guitar. If you yearn to take your guitar playing down country roads and through the Rocky Mountains, then Learn Folk Guitar with the Music of John Denver is uniquely for you. Starting right now you can learn everything you need to know to begin playing folk guitar-fingerpicking, strumming techniques, pick techniques, arranging, and more-by exploring the music of John Denver. With examples taken from the music he made famous, as well as full arrangements of some of his best-known songs, this book will have you strumming and picking in no time. A CD is included with recorded examples. 72 pages
Born and raised in Brooklyn, NY, Pasquale Bianculli began playing the guitar at the age of 13 under Joseph Cassano. In 1972, he began intensive srudy in classical guitar with ]erry Willard and Edgard Dana at the Guitar Workshop in Oyster Bay, NY. He received his M. Mus. degree from the State University of New York at Stony Brook in 1981, and holds a certificate from Teachers College Columbia Univcrsity as a Performing Artist in the Schools. As a recitalist, he has been heard across the D.S., Canada, Europe, and the Caribbean. In 1983, he made his New York solo debur at Weill Recital Hall at Carnegie Hall. He has had the honor of performing for the legendary guitarist Andres Segovia in Granada, Spain. Both he and his wife, flurist Kathy McDonald, taught at the Edna Manley School of the Arts in Kingston, Jamaica, performing throughout that country. Together with guitarist Harris Becker, he formed Guitar x2 and, in 1999, released a CD of music for rwo guitars, Catgut Flambo, on the Musicians Showcase Recordings label. The composer Carlo Domeniconi wrote and dedicated his Long Island Suite to the duo in 2002. Pat has been on the faculties of Dowling College and the Pasquale Bianculli Rocky Ridge Music Center in Colorado and has served as adjudicator in music competitions sponsored by Queens College and the American String Teacher's Association. Currently, he is on the faculty of C. W Post Campus of Long Island University and the United Nations International School. This is his second book for Cherry Lane Music Publishing, his first being 101 Tips and Tricks/or Acoustic Guitar. This book is dedicated to Kathleen.
